Metallized ceramics are leading the way in cutting-edge technology, serving as a seamless conduit between ceramics and metals. These sophisticated materials are transforming a variety of industries, such as electronics, automotive, aerospace, and beyond. To delve deeper into the revolutionary capabilities of metallized ceramics, we consulted several industry specialists who provided valuable perspectives on this remarkable technology.

Exploring the Transformational Advantages of Metallized Ceramics

As Dr. Emily Taylor, a materials scientist at Tech Innovations, articulates, "Metallized ceramics merge the superior qualities of both ceramics and metals. They demonstrate remarkable thermal stability, electrical conductivity, and robust mechanical properties. This amalgamation makes them exceptionally suitable for situations where conventional materials fall short." Their capacity to endure extreme conditions while retaining their effectiveness marks a significant advancement across multiple fields.

Elevating Electronic Component Efficiency

Among the most critical uses of metallized ceramics is within the electronics sector. Dr. Alan Wright, a specialist in electronic materials, notes, "With the growing demand for compactness in electronic devices, metallized ceramics serve as a trustworthy remedy. Their superior thermal conductivity facilitates effective heat dissipation, which is essential in averting overheating in tightly packed designs." This has catalyzed their integration in components such as capacitors, resistors, and substrates across many high-tech electronic gadgets.

Innovations in the Automotive Sector

In the automotive industry, metallized ceramics are leading initiatives to create more efficient machines and components. Prof. Lisa Chen, an automotive engineer, asserts, "Incorporating metallized ceramics into engine components allows for a substantial reduction in weight without sacrificing power. These materials are capable of withstanding higher temperatures than standard metals, paving the way for innovative engine designs." This results not only in improved fuel economy but also aids in lowering overall emissions.

Transformative Applications in Aerospace

The aerospace sector is particularly enthusiastic about the prospects of metallized ceramics. Dr. Michael Robinson, a researcher specializing in aeronautical engineering, observes, "These materials excel in surviving under extreme pressure and temperature conditions, making them vital for aerospace applications. They can be utilized in numerous components, such as thermal barrier coatings and structural supports, which are essential for aircraft durability and reliability." Their ability to decrease weight while bolstering strength contributes to safer, more economical flights.

Advancements in Medical Technology

Additionally, the healthcare industry is harnessing the power of metallized ceramics for various functions. Dr. Sarah Patel, a biomedical engineer, underscores, "It is crucial that medical devices utilize materials that are both biocompatible and possess electronic capabilities. The application of metallized ceramics in implantable devices requiring electrical stimulation leads to better functionality and improved patient outcomes." This integration of diverse functions exemplifies their adaptability to meet various needs.

Prospects for the Future of Metallized Ceramics

With the ever-increasing need for advanced materials, the outlook for metallized ceramics is encouraging. Dr. Jessica Green, a nanotechnology researcher, concludes, "Continuous exploration in nanomaterials and composites is expected to advance the creation of novel metallized ceramic forms. These developments will further optimize their capabilities, making them suitable for an even broader array of industries. As we uncover their potential, the key question isn't whether they will change technology fundamentally—but rather to what extent they will do so."

In sum, metallized ceramics are opening new doors in technology, improving everything from electronic device efficiency to enhancing the safety of aerospace functionalities. As professionals continue to investigate and enhance these materials, we can anticipate even more groundbreaking advancements in the future.
